Collective Bargaining Update

Posted 1 March 2012 by Rebecca Muratore (University of Melbourne)

This year the NTEU will be negotiating with Melbourne University a new Collective Agreement, which seeks to improve upon your wages and working conditions. The Branch Committee has started to develop a log of claims, but we know there a number of issues out there that members want addressed in the next agreement. We want to hear from you! Come along to a members meeting at your campus to hear from your branch committee and organizer how you can have your say about what issues are important to you, and help shape the log of claims for your collective agreement. Meetings will be held at:

Parkville: Thursday 22nd March 1:10pm - Medical-Wright Theatre (Medical Building Rm: C403)

Southbank: Tuesday 27th March 10:30am- Staff Lounge

Dookie: Tuesday 3rd April 12:30pm (Venue TBC)

Shepparton (Rural Health Academic Centre): Tuesday 3rd April 2:30pm-Tute Room 1

Creswick: Wednesday 4th April 11:30am- Stage 2 Seminar room.

(Meetings at other campuses will be confirmed shortly, and members will be notified)
